How do you identify the integers in the list below?

To identify integers in a given list, look for whole numbers that can be positive, negative, or zero, without any fractional or decimal components. Check each item in the list to see if it meets this criterion. For example, numbers like -3, 0, and 5 are integers, while 2.5 and -1.75 are not. Use a systematic approach, such as filtering or iterating through the list, to isolate these integers.

How do you find the two consecutive integers of a number?

To find two consecutive integers of a given number ( n ), first, identify the integer part of ( n ) if it is not already an integer. The two consecutive integers can be expressed as ( \lfloor n \rfloor ) and ( \lfloor n \rfloor + 1 ). For example, if ( n ) is 4.7, the consecutive integers would be 4 and 5. If ( n ) is already an integer, simply take ( n ) and ( n + 1 ).


How would you use a number line to order integers from greatest to least?

To order integers from greatest to least on a number line, first identify the positions of each integer on the line. The integers that are farther to the right represent greater values, while those to the left represent lesser values. Starting from the rightmost integer, you would list the integers in descending order until you reach the leftmost one. This visual representation helps clearly see the relative sizes of the integers and facilitates accurate ordering.
